Muthoot MCred Limited (formerly known as Muthoottu Mini Financiers Limited), one of India’s trusted gold loan NBFCs, announced strong financial performance for the quarter ended June 30, 2026. Profit After Tax (PAT) increased by 232.73% year-on-year to ₹100.29 crore. AUM grew 58.53% year-on-year to ₹7,098.38 crore. Total income stood at ₹399.64 crore in Q1 FY27, registering a 76.38% year-on-year growth.

The Company continued to maintain strong asset quality and operational discipline, with Gross NPA at 0.59% and Net NPA at 0.24% as of June 30, 2026. Return on Assets (ROA) improved significantly to 5.17% in Q1 FY27, compared with 2.84% as of March 31, 2026, reflecting a strong improvement in the Company’s profitability and asset utilisation. The ROA achieved during the quarter positions Muthoot MCred among the leading performers in the industry.

Electrotherm (India) reported standalone PAT of Rs 6.86 crore in Q1FY27, down over 75% from Rs 27.67 crore in Q1FY26.

Board approved allotment of 6 per cent non-cumulative redeemable preference shares of ₹10 each to five existing preference shareholders, excluding Ahmedabad Aviation and Aeronautics Limited, in lieu of redemption of the existing preference shares. The allotment amounts to ₹10.95 crore and will be on the same terms and conditions as the original issue.

The company will also redeem 10,50,000 preference shares of ₹10 each at par, amounting to ₹1.05 crore, to Ahmedabad Aviation and Aeronautics Limited, a non-consenting preference shareholder
